Given f(x) = 2x + 9, if f(x) = 15, find x.
Respuesta :
flcral9230
flcral9230
11-11-2019
if f(x) = 15, then rewrite the equation replacing the f(x) with 15
15 = 2x + 9
subtract 9 from sides
15 - 9 = 6
9 - 9 = 0
then, you would be left with 6 = 2x
divide by 2 on both sides
6/2 = 3
2x/2 = x
x would be 3 :)
